Luis Napoleón Bonaparte, also known as Louis Napoleon, was elected the first president of France in 1848, marking a significant political shift in the country's history. His presidency set the stage for his later declaration as Emperor Napoleon III, and his leadership was notable for its authoritarian measures and efforts to modernize France, as well as for his involvement in various military campaigns across Europe.
